The full package, often referred to as Stingray Studio, bundles several specialized components into one integrated library:

Objective Grid: A high-performance grid component for building spreadsheet-like interfaces with support for formulas and database connectivity.

Objective Toolkit: A collection of over 70 GUI controls, including docking windows, customizable toolbars, and layout managers.

Objective Chart: A graphing engine providing more than 30 chart types, including 2D/3D visualizations and curve-fitting.

Objective Edit: A specialized text editor component featuring syntax coloring and IDE-like capabilities.

Objective Views: A canvas-based drawing component for building diagrams and drag-and-drop interfaces.

Stingray Foundation Library (SFL): The architectural backbone that provides the Model-View-Controller (MVC) framework and OLE drag-and-drop support. Integration & Use Cases What's New in Stingray - Perforce Software

Perforce Stingray (formerly Stingray Studio) is a comprehensive C++ library and GUI development framework designed for building high-performance Windows applications. It provides developers with reusable MFC-based (Microsoft Foundation Class) components that handle low-level UI details, allowing focus on core business logic and end-user requirements. Stingray is divided into specialized modules tailored for different UI needs:

Objective Grid: A full-featured, object-oriented grid control that supports hierarchical data viewing and embedded controls.

Objective Toolkit: A set of MFC extension classes for common UI features like docking windows, which emulate the look and feel of modern IDEs like Visual Studio.

Objective Views: A comprehensive set of classes for creating and manipulating 2D graphics and symbols on a diagramming surface.

Objective Edit: A source code syntax highlighting library that can be integrated into applications to support languages like C++, HTML, and JavaScript.

Objective Chart: An extension library for adding complex, high-efficiency charting and graphing capabilities to Windows apps. Key Technical Capabilities

Data Connectivity: Supports direct connections to data sources via ODBC and ADO, enabling real-time data visualization in custom spreadsheets.

Modern Architecture: Uses a Model-View-Controller (MVC) architecture and is fully integrated with the MFC document/view framework.
